Fluffy Homemade Biscuits with Honey Glaze: Perfect for Any Meal

There’s nothing like the soft, buttery texture of homemade biscuits fresh out of the oven. These fluffy, melt-in-your-mouth biscuits are topped with a sweet honey glaze that perfectly complements their savory flavor. Whether you enjoy them with breakfast, as a side for dinner, or as a snack, these biscuits are sure to become a household favorite.


Ingredients

For the Biscuits:

  • 2 cups (250g) all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• ½ cup (115g) unsalted butter, cold and cubed
  • 1 cup (240ml) buttermilk (or regular milk if unavailable)

For the Honey Glaze:

  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ract


Instructions

Step 1: Prepare the Biscuit Dough

  1. Preheat your oven to 450°F (232°C).
  2. In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, salt, and baking soda.
  3. Add the cold, cubed butter to the flour mixture. Using a pastry cutter or your hands, work the butter into the flour until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
  4. Pour in the buttermilk and stir gently until just combined. Be careful not to overwork the dough. If it’s too sticky, add a little more flour until it forms a soft dough.

Step 2: Roll and Cut the Biscuits

  1.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ured surface. Roll it out to about 1-inch thickness.
  2. Using a round biscuit cutter (or a glass), cut the dough into circles. Be sure to press straight down without twisting to ensure the biscuits rise properly.
  3. Place the biscuits on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per, making sure they are touching slightly for a soft edge.

Step 3: Bake the Biscuits

  1. Bake the biscuits in the preheated oven for 10-12 minutes, or until they are golden brown on top.
  2. Remove from the oven and let them cool slightly on a wire rack.

Step 4: Prepare the Honey Glaze

  1. In a small saucepan, melt the butter over low heat.
  2. Add the honey and vanilla extract, stirring until smooth and combined.
  3. Once the biscuits are slightly cooled, brush the warm honey glaze over the tops of the biscuits for a sweet, shiny finish.

Step 5: Serve and Enjoy

  1. Serve the biscuits warm with butter, jam, or any meal of your choice. Enjoy the soft, fluffy texture paired with the sweet honey glaze.

Tips for Perfect Biscuits

  1. Cold Butter: The key to flaky biscuits is cold butter. Make sure your butter is chilled before adding it to the dry ingredients.
  2. Don’t Overmix: Overworking the dough can lead to tough biscuits. Mix until just combined for the best results.
  3. Use Buttermilk: Buttermilk adds flavor and helps the biscuits rise beautifully. If you don’t have buttermilk, regular milk will work, but the texture may be slightly different.
